  • When life gives you lemons ... In this video I am showing you a simple method how to make candied lemon peel that you can use in your holiday baking, for snacking, or for cocktails.
    All you need is
    lemons (or any citrus such as orange or grapefruit)
    water and
    organic sugar amzn.to/2L6wIRt
    - and a bit of time.
